Ingredients
2 lbs chicken drumsticks
1 sliced yellow onion
1/4 cup Olive oil
2 tsp dried rosemary
1 tsp paprika
1/2 tsp Kosher salt
1/4 tsp black pepper
1 cup chicken broth
1/2 tbsp. Garlic powder
Directions
Place drumsticks and onions around bottom of slow cooker
In a separate bowl, mix together olive oil, rosemary, paprika, salt, pepper, and garlic. Pour over drumsticks
Add broth to slow cooker
Cook on high for 4 hours or low for 7-8 hours
Transfer drumsticks to pan and broil for 3 minutes each side
